About this home
Imagine a twenty-first century home with the character of a seventeenth-century farmhouse. This home with its slate floors, natural fir ceilings, and working, wood-burning fireplaces gives an impression of age while its modern construction and amenities such as radiant heating, air conditioning, and brand-new appliances offer the reassurance of not only convenience but also reliability. Its location at the end of a long, private driveway and its impressive view of the surrounding mountains give the property a restorative air, making the hustle and bustle of the world seem a thing of the past once you cross the threshold. Perhaps the seller said it best when he said, “If you’re looking for peace and quiet, well… this is it. " No drivebys please.

This "New England Connected Farm" style home is sited on 46+/- acres, 2 lots, at the top of a tranquil Meadow on the South slope of Morgan Hill. At 1100 feet above sea level with pastoral views below and mountain views of Mount Ascutney, Grantham Mountain, Croydon Mountain and Colby Hill enjoyed from almost every room. Perfectly sited at the edge of the meadow, and adjacent to more than 1000 acres of conserved woodlands, the home is peaceful and quiet while the setting is spectacular. Surrounded by great schools, private and public, beautiful lakes for fishing, boating and recreation, numerous ski areas as well as historic sites within a short drive, this home offers you the best of all worlds!
